I have only seen the first episode but I have a good feeling about "The Intruders". It grabs you from the start and uses a clever plot to keep you wondering and asking yourself questions. I hope it holds this level for the rest of the series. I think the idea behind the story line is good and well written. Some great acting from a young cast and I think it has a touch of "Fringe" and "X files" about it. UK Actor John Simm adds a further dimension to the plot as the moody ex cop. It's not another cop series. it's not wildly complex or too 'out there' Its really quite believable and I found myself hooked. This has the makings of an excellent series if the writers and producers don't cut the budget. It's hard these days to find a good series to hold your interest but I feel this one does. it's well worth a look.
